💰 Golden Nuggets — Divisional Round Predictions

Saturday, January 9th

Packers (-7) 24 — Rams 17
The Packers have been awesome all year and have one of the most potent offenses in football featuring the NFL MVP Aaron Rodgers. The Packers should be able to score enough to win this game. The big questions for the Rams is the injury report. Is Aaron Donald going to be at full strength? Is Jared Goff going to start? I trust Sean McVay to have a strong game plan, but this feels an uphill battle for LA.

Bills (-2.5) 24 — Ravens 21
The Bills offense keeps on cooking, while the Ravens offense did just enough against the Titans to win. The Ravens defense has been awesome for the better part of a month, while the Bills defense struggled versus the Colts. Can the Ravens take advantage of the Bills’ rushing defense? If they can, I see a path to victory. But do you really want to bet against the Bills in Buffalo right now? They’re the hottest team in the NFL. This should be a great one.

Sunday, January 17th

Chiefs 41 (-10) — Browns 24
The Browns are coming off an electric victory versus Pittsburgh and get their head coach back. The Chiefs haven’t played a meaningful game in almost a month. So, let down spot for Kansas City? I don’t think so.
The Browns won their Super Bowl last week against the Steelers. This feels to me like a get right game for KC.

Buccaneers 30 — Saints 27 (-3.5)
The Saints keep on humming, but watch out because Tom Brady is in playoff mode. New Orleans has beaten the Brady Bunch twice this year, but it’s really difficult to beat a team as good as Tampa Bay three times in a season. The Saints offense has sputtered at times and I think the Bucs can get enough pressure on Drew Brees to cause mistakes. I’ll take the Bucs in an upset.
